Life-saving appliances
Embarkation ladder
- IMO code
- LSS018
- ISO 7010 number
- E053
Where you will meet it
At the survival craft boarding points, where you climb down the ship’s side to reach them.
What it means in practice
The ladder you climb down from the deck to a boat or raft on the water.
Legal basis
Annex to IMO resolution A.1116(30) (adopted 05.12.2017), table of life-saving appliance markings. Mandatory on ships built from 01.01.2019; older ships may carry signs per resolution A.760(18). Requirements for the equipment itself: SOLAS chapter III and the LSA Code. Graphic pattern of the symbol: ISO 7010.
